Sr. Technical Lead – Advanced Engineering Location: Whitehouse station, NJ or Remote Duration: 6 months + CTH Job description The ‘Sr. Technical Lead’ will be responsible to provide technical leadership on end-to-end development & delivery of new insurance products & capabilities enabling new business opportunities and operational efficiencies utilizing DevOps and SAFe Agile on Client.IO Platform and its adoptions with various lines of business. This role is also responsible for all integrations and interfaces upstream as well as downstream supporting business objectives. This role will require the candidate to technically lead globally distributed development teams to deliver products and services in the most efficient way possible. This role requires hands-on knowledge of building cloud native applications using open source technologies, strong technical background, design thinking, seamless execution, strong relationship management and effective communication capabilities. The Sr. Technical Lead will be accountable for planning, directing and coordinating medium to large scale, moderately complex projects; ensuring that the goals and objectives are accomplished with high quality, within established time frames and meet customer and/or business needs. The Sr. Technical Lead will design and implement products for continuous delivery of features and capabilities aligned with business priorities. Scope/Responsibilities
- You will be responsible for the application design and problem solving, and will be accountable for building secure and scalable solutions
- You will be hands-on with projects, getting deep into design and code
- Mentor Junior Engineers
- Lead end-to-end development, implementation and integration of new insurance products, packages utilizing Client.IO Platform.
- Partner with Product Manager/Owner, BA, Developers and enterprise teams to define and deliver optimum application and solution architecture to meet current and future underwriting and policy admin platform needs.
- Lead high level design, review code and implementation by the development teams.
- Communicate regularly in accordance with agreed upon communications plan.
- Prepare technical documentations and deliver formal presentations for sprint and system demos.
- Leverage agile-based operating model across multiple Scrum teams.
- Able to multi-task across different product implementations.
- Manage production workloads and act as an SME for L3 issues.
Qualifications, Skills, Knowledge, and Experience:
- Bachelor’s or Master’s Degree in Computer Science, Information Systems, or another related field.
- Overall 10 -15 years of IT experience.
- At least 3-5 years experience in Insurance domain (P&C) with implementations in new business and renewals business processes.
- At least 3 years of cloud native application development using docker, Kubernetes
- Experience in Causality & Property lines platform/systems implementation is preferred
- Experience in technology stack such as Java, Spring Boot, Camel, Camunda, Drools, XML, CSS, XSLT, Elasticsearch, Logstash, Kibana (ELK), Unqork, Prometheus, Grafana etc.,
- Deep, hands-on knowledge of Microservices & API Mgmt., Cloud Platforms such as Microsoft Azure and DevOps process is required.
- Good knowledge of Data & Analytics technologies such as Data Lakes, Business Intelligence Tools, Predictive Models, 3rd Party Data.
- Experience in development of REST based APIs using Open API specification and/or creating specifications w/swagger
- Experience in configuring DevOps continuous integration and continuous deployment pipelines
- Perform complex troubleshooting of critical problem tickets, resolving defects in existing production software and provide root-cause analysis
- Hands-on experience working with code quality and code coverage tools/frameworks
- Understanding of how to secure webapps and APIs using OpenID/OAuth2.0 standards.
- Experience in caching technologies and search is a plus
- Ability to motivate team members and effectively delegate responsibilities to ensure timely delivery.
- Excellent written/verbal skills and demonstrated ability to meet commitments under pressure.
Key Behaviors and Competencies
- Has demonstrated the ability to work well with others
- An excellent communicator and collaborator across multiple technical and business stakeholders and leaders.
- Must be a self-starter, work without supervision.
- Ability to take full ownership of work and show initiative as needed.
- Strong analytical skills and influence skills to achieve results.
- Strong ability to identify, understand and communicate business needs and complex technical concepts in simple, concise and crisp manner to technical and non-technical audiences.
• Other competencies include: o Models company values; demonstrates high integrity; meets commitments; o Demonstrates sense of urgency and accountability; sets priorities and acts on key issues; o Demonstrates bias to be proactive rather than reactive; o Team player mentality; prioritize organizational performance
drools API Business Analyst Troubleshooting Analytical skills Computer Science Azure web-applications Communication Elasticsearch Prometheus Docker XML XSLT Grafana unqork microservices Cloud Native systems Kibana Product management Business Intelligence (BI) CI/CD Data Analyst Verbal communication Spring Boot Design Thinking cloud-platforms Data lake Predictive models Team player clean code principles apache-camel Multitasking api-management DevOps logstash Collaboration code-coverage Meeting deadlines Written communication skills Kubernetes Information Systems Java Scrum openid camunda CSS Initiative